Time the record covers

At least 10 million years on record.

The record covers at least 15.98 Mya to 5.333 Mya. No occurrence read is dated outside 20.45 Mya to 2.58 Mya.

10 occurrences of Hildebrandia pantanellii on record, most of them in the Miocene. The Paleobiology Database records this as a living group, and the chart stops with its fossils rather than at the present. Bar height is expected occurrences, not a count: each fossil is spread across the span it is dated to, so a tall narrow bar means tight dating and a low wide one means loose.
